Transaction 077833e46cf954229fefa078475b2ed5e1399d5e3701ad556dcd588405379299
1 Input
1 Output
-
077833e46cf954229fefa078475b2ed5e1399d5e3701ad556dcd588405379299:0
- value
- 16485097
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e73c6be23e91423b213eb44087509936711ce513 OP_EQUAL
- address
- 3NmgQ1Zbu4Q3L6t8p2qmVU9BdBjVEk3WLm